Game Info
Date | June 26, 1914 |
---|---|
Day of Week | Fri |
Day / Night | D |
Visiting Team | Cleveland Indians |
Home Team | St. Louis Browns |
Visiting Starting Pitcher | Allan Collamore |
Home Starting Pitcher | Earl Hamilton |
Ballpark | Sportsman's Park |
City | St. Louis |
State | MO |
Attendance | 1,200 |
Time of Game | 1 hour 50 minutes |
Umpires | HP: Jack Egan 1B: Billy Evans 2B: (none) 3B: (none) |
Cleveland Indians Lineup
Name | Position |
---|---|
Jack Graney | Left Fielder |
Terry Turner | Third Baseman |
Nemo Leibold | Center Fielder |
Nap Lajoie | Second Baseman |
Doc Johnston | First Baseman |
Roy Wood | Right Fielder |
Ray Chapman | Shortstop |
Steve O'Neill | Catcher |
Allan Collamore | Pitcher |
Joe Birmingham | Manager |
St. Louis Browns Lineup
Name | Position |
---|---|
Burt Shotton | Center Fielder |
Del Pratt | Second Baseman |
Gus Williams | Right Fielder |
Tillie Walker | Left Fielder |
John Leary | First Baseman |
Jimmy Austin | Third Baseman |
Doc Lavan | Shortstop |
Frank Crossin | Catcher |
Earl Hamilton | Pitcher |
Branch Rickey | Manager |
